Understanding the Basics: What is Cryptanalysis?
Before we dive into the details of the certificate, it’s crucial to understand the fundamental concept of cryptanalysis. Simply put, cryptanalysis is the practice of analyzing cryptographic algorithms and systems to identify weaknesses or vulnerabilities that could be exploited. It involves both the creation and the breaking of codes, making it a fascinating and challenging field.

Career Opportunities
The skills you’ll gain through this certificate open up a wide range of career opportunities in the cybersecurity field. Here are some of the career paths you might consider:
1. Cybersecurity Analyst: As a cybersecurity analyst, you’ll be responsible for assessing and mitigating risks in an organization’s IT infrastructure. This role often involves implementing and maintaining secure communication protocols.
2. Cryptographic Engineer: In this role, you’ll focus on designing and implementing cryptographic systems. You might work on developing new cryptographic algorithms or improving existing ones.
3. Penetration Tester: As a penetration tester, you’ll work to identify vulnerabilities in systems and networks by simulating attacks. This role is crucial in ensuring that systems are secure and resilient.
4. Security Consultant: As a security consultant, you’ll advise organizations on how to improve their cybersecurity posture. This might involve training staff, implementing security policies, or designing secure communication systems.
